  1. anticlinoriumnoun

    A series of parallel anticlinal folds on a regional-scale anticline.

  1. anticlinorium

    In structural geology, an anticline is a type of fold that is an arch-like shape and has its oldest beds at its core, whereas a syncline is the inverse of an anticline. A typical anticline is convex up in which the hinge or crest is the location where the curvature is greatest, and the limbs are the sides of the fold that dip away from the hinge. Anticlines can be recognized and differentiated from antiforms by a sequence of rock layers that become progressively older toward the center of the fold. Therefore, if age relationships between various rock strata are unknown, the term antiform should be used. The progressing age of the rock strata towards the core and uplifted center, are the trademark indications for evidence of anticlines on a geologic map. These formations occur because anticlinal ridges typically develop above thrust faults during crustal deformations. The uplifted core of the fold causes compression of strata that preferentially erodes to a deeper stratigraphic level relative to the topographically lower flanks. Motion along the fault including both shortening and extension of tectonic plates, usually also deforms strata near the fault. This can result in an asymmetrical or overturned fold.

  1. anticlinorium

    An anticlinorium is a large, elongated fold in the Earth's crust that is characterized by a series of anticlines and synclines arranged in a linear or curving pattern. It is typically formed by compressional forces in the Earth's crust, causing rocks to bend and fold into a series of upward-arching anticlines and downward-arching synclines. Anticlinoria can be found in a variety of geological settings, such as mountain ranges, and are often associated with the accumulation of sedimentary rocks.

  1. Anticlinoriumnoun

    the upward elevation of the crust of the earth, resulting from a geanticlinal

  2. Etymology: [NL., fr. Gr. 'anti` against + kli`nein to incline + 'o`ros mountain.]
